Research Associate | Imperial College London | 2018–2019
- Mathematician within the Non-Destructive Evaluation group, which develops ultrasonic measurement techniques for detecting flaws in mechanical components.
- Development of ultrasonic imaging algorithms for pipe inspections (corrosion in difficult-to-inspect locations). This included software development in Matlab, and the design of deep learning algorithms for image processing (a convolutional autoencoder built with Pytorch).
- Simulation of metamaterials, a hypothesised mechanism for sound damping in moth wings that is thought to aid them in avoiding predation by echolocating bats (joint work with the Mathematics department).
PhD Researcher | University College London | 2014–2018
- I was a member of the Biomedical Ultrasound Group, which develops new ultrasonic therapies (e.g. cancer ablation, neuro-stimulation) and associated modelling and simulation tools. I also collaborated with computer science researchers at Brno University of Technology.
- I contributed to the development of the k-Wave Matlab toolbox for medical ultrasound simulation. This has over 10,000 registered users and more than 700 citations.
- My research included four projects, which tackled different aspects of the computational efficiency of the mathematics (Fourier collocation) underlying the toolbox’s acoustic model.
- I authored 7 journal papers and 2 conference papers based on work conducted here.
Mathematician | Commonwealth Scientific & Industrial Research Organisation | 2013–2014
- This is Australia’s national science agency, whose chief role is to improve the economic and social performance of Australian industry.
- My role was within Mathematics, Statistics, and Informatics, primarily applying modelling and numerical simulations to materials science problems, including:
- Designing a polymer filter to bind and capture proteins for antimicrobial use. Involved molecular dynamics and metadynamics simulations (NAMD, LAAMPS).
- Improving the lifespan of ion thrusters (a form of spacecraft propulsion) though better material choice informed by simulations of sputtering.
- Finite-element modelling (COMSOL) the transverse deformation in carbon fibres to aid characterisation of elastic properties.
- I also collaborated with a gender studies scholar to investigate changes to the content of AfterEllen (a queer pop-culture news site) before and after its acquisition by MTV. This involved web-scraping and topic modelling.
